About Apogee Enterprises
Apogee Enterprises, Inc. provides architectural products and services for enclosing buildings, and glass and acrylic products used for preservation, protection, and enhanced viewing in the United States, Canada, and Brazil. The company operates in four segments: Architectural Framing Systems, Architectural Glass, Architectural Services, and Large-Scale Optical (LSO). The Architectural Framing Systems segment designs, engineers, fabricates, finishes, and installs custom glass and aluminum window, curtainwall, storefront, and entrance systems for the exterior of buildings primarily in the non-residential construction sectors. The Architectural Glass segment provides a range of high-performance glass products for use in windows, curtainwall, storefront, and entrance systems. The Architectural Services segment integrates technical services, project management, and field installation services to design, engineer, fabricate, and install building glass and curtainwall systems. The LSO segment manufactures high-performance glazing products for the custom framing, fine art, and engineered optics markets. The company’s products and services are primarily used in commercial buildings, such as office buildings, hotels, and retail centers; institutional buildings comprising education facilities, health care facilities, and government buildings; transportation facilities, such as airports and transit terminals, as well as multi-family residential buildings. It markets its architectural products and services through direct sales force, independent sales representatives, distributors, and glazing subcontractors and general contractors; and value-added glass and acrylics through retail chains, as well as independent distributors to museums, galleries, and other customers. The company was incorporated in 1949 and is based in Minneapolis, Minnesota.
About Schweiter Technologies
Schweiter Technologies AG, together with its subsidiaries, develops, produces, and sells composite materials and solutions in lightweight construction in Europe, the Americas, Asia, and internationally. The company provides extruded and cast plastic, lightweight panels, aluminum composite panels, core materials based on balsa wood, and PET foam. It offers its products under the Airex, Alucobond, Baltek, Dibond, Forex, Gator, Kapa, Perspex, Sintra, Dispa, Crylon, and Crylux brands. The company also provides property management and management services. Its products are used in the visual communication, architecture, wind energy, industry, train and bus manufacturing, and marine engineering industries. The company was incorporated in 1912 and is headquartered in Steinhausen, Switzerland.
